Commercial siding installation involves attaching durable and high-quality exterior panels to the outside of a building. This service typically includes preparing the building surface, selecting appropriate siding materials, and professionally installing the panels to ensure a secure and attractive finish. Proper installation helps protect the building from weather elements like wind, rain, and snow, while also enhancing its overall appearance. Local contractors experienced in commercial siding can handle projects for various property types, ensuring the siding is installed correctly and efficiently.
Many property owners turn to commercial siding installation to address common problems such as damaged or deteriorating exterior surfaces, drafts, and insulation issues. Over time, exposure to harsh weather can cause siding to crack, warp, or fade, leading to reduced energy efficiency and increased maintenance costs. Installing new siding can help resolve these issues by providing a fresh, weather-resistant barrier that improves insulation and prevents further damage. The overview below groups typical Commercial Siding Installation proj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Denver, CO.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or siding repairs in Denver range from $250 to $600, covering patching, sealing, or replacing small sections. Many routine maintenance jobs fall within this range, depending on the extent of damage and material type.
Mid-Range Installations - Full siding replacement projects for average-sized homes often cost between $3,000 and $8,000. Most local contractors handle projects in this range, with fewer jobs reaching higher prices for premium materials or complex designs.
Large or Complex Projects - Larger, more intricate siding installations, such as multi-story buildings or custom designs, can exceed $10,000 and may reach $20,000+ in some cases. These projects are less common but are handled by experienced service providers in the area.
Material Variations - Costs vary significantly based on siding material, with vinyl typically costing $3 to $8 per square foot, while fiber cement or wood can range from $7 to $15 or more. Local pros can provide detailed estimates based on specific material choices and project scope.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

Commercial siding installation is often needed when property owners in Denver notice their building’s exterior showing signs of wear or damage, such as cracking, warping, or fading. These issues can be caused by Denver’s variable weather, including harsh winters and intense sun exposure, which can accelerate the deterioration of siding materials. Property owners may seek out local contractors to replace or upgrade their siding to improve curb appeal, protect the building’s structure, or comply with property standards, especially for retail spaces, offices, or multi-family buildings.
Additionally, many property owners in Denver consider siding upgrades when preparing for property sales or renovations, aiming to boost the building’s exterior appearance and value. Weather-related concerns like moisture infiltration or drafts can also prompt the need for new siding installation.
